Position: Instrument Technician (Commissioning & Installation)
Location: Cheshire
Salary: GBP40k-GBP50k
My client is looking to expand their Instrument Department of 8 technicians to accommodate the steady growth of the company. They have a relaxed, friendly, and professional attitude with a great focus on personal training and growth.
The Role:
Install, commission, and maintain various types of instruments and control systems.
Troubleshoot breakdowns across various customer sites and industries.
Read and interpret electrical schematics, drawings, and loop sheets.
Collaborate with other technicians and engineers to ensure proper functioning of instrumentation, control panels, and complete control systems.
Test instruments for accuracy and reliability.
Document activities and keep accurate digital records for both customer and in-house projects.
Assist all other departments in design elements of projects, specification of new instrumentation, installation, set-up, and commissioning both in-house and at customer sites.
Your role as an Instrument Technician would mainly be based around the Cheshire area and North West. Occasional work away within the UK may be required but not for long periods. You would be welcomed into the existing Technician team with a view to becoming an important member of the company striving to achieve excellent customer service and carry out all work to the highest standards.
They cover a wide array of industries including Pharmaceutical, Food and Beverage, Petro-Chemical, Utilities, Car Industry, and Aerospace.
The work they carry out is both interesting and challenging, requiring team members to be proactive and supportive to find solutions.
They offer a Flexitime system which allows overtime hours to be either taken as pay or additional time off.
0.5 day additional holiday is offered for every year served.
Overtime is plentiful but not mandatory.
Training is provided where required for personal and company growth. They strongly support apprentices' growth and experience as part of their company culture.
Requirements:
High school diploma or equivalent required; technical degree or certification preferred.
Strong knowledge of electrical systems, circuits, and components.
Excellent problem-solving skills and ability to diagnose instrument/control issues.
Customer service-oriented mindset with good communication skills.
ATEX qualifications would be preferable but not essential. Training can be provided.
Own transport is essential for travel to customer sites, with all business mileage generously reimbursed.
Basic computer literacy required (Word, Excel, etc.).
